Web24 aug. 2024 · Put on a pair of rubber gloves and completely coat the burnt-on food in the cookware with oven cleaner. Seal the cookware in a garbage bag, making sure to close the bag tightly to prevent the fumes from escaping. Let the cookware sit overnight. How To Clean Burnt Casserole Dish - With Pictures

Web30 mei 2024 · Add baking soda: Sprinkle a liberal amount of baking soda along the bottom of the casserole dish. Add dish soap: Add a couple squirts of dish soap, then fill the casserole dish with piping-hot water. Let it sit on a flat surface for at least 15 minutes, but as long as overnight. Web17 okt. 2016 · Put your stained Pyrex dish in the tub. Dip your brush into the dilute lye and apply it to the stains on the Pyrex. Light stains will almost instantly dissolve, evidenced by brownish drips down the side. Heavier stains, such as caked-on casserole, burnt meat, or pie crust may require a second or third application.
